1
0

Delete article

Deleted articles cannot be recovered.

Draft of this article would be also deleted.

Are you sure you want to delete this article?

新たなDatabricksダッシュボードのウォークスルー

Posted at

以前こちらでウォークスルーした新ダッシュボードであるLakeviewがGAになりました。

GAに伴い、Lakeviewと呼んでいたものが標準のダッシュボードになり、従来のダッシュボードはレガシーとなりました。

こちらのチュートリアルをウォークスルーします。

ダッシュボードの作成

作成メニューでダッシュボードを選ぶとLakeviewダッシュボードが作成されます、
Screenshot 2024-05-02 at 18.05.02.png

データの定義

ここでは、タクシー乗降記録のサンプルデータを使用します。

左上のデータタブをクリックします。
Screenshot 2024-05-02 at 18.05.23.png

SQLから作成をクリックします。テーブルのデータをそのまま使用する際には、テーブルを選択でも大丈夫です。
Screenshot 2024-05-02 at 18.05.41.png

以下のSQLを貼り付けます。

SELECT
  T.tpep_pickup_datetime,
  T.tpep_dropoff_datetime,
  T.fare_amount,
  T.pickup_zip,
  T.dropoff_zip,
  T.trip_distance,
  T.weekday,
  CASE
    WHEN T.weekday = 1 THEN 'Sunday'
    WHEN T.weekday = 2 THEN 'Monday'
    WHEN T.weekday = 3 THEN 'Tuesday'
    WHEN T.weekday = 4 THEN 'Wednesday'
    WHEN T.weekday = 5 THEN 'Thursday'
    WHEN T.weekday = 6 THEN 'Friday'
    WHEN T.weekday = 7 THEN 'Saturday'
    ELSE 'N/A'
  END AS day_of_week,
  T.fare_amount,
  T.trip_distance
FROM
  (
    SELECT
      dayofweek(tpep_pickup_datetime) as weekday,
      *
    FROM
      `samples`.`nyctaxi`.`trips`
    WHERE
      trip_distance > 0
      AND trip_distance < 10
      AND fare_amount > 0
      AND fare_amount < 50
  ) T
ORDER BY
  T.weekday

クエリーを実行して結果を表示させます。
Screenshot 2024-05-02 at 18.07.45.png

ビジュアライゼーションの作成

Cavasタブをクリックしてキャンバスに戻ります。ここでビジュアライゼーションの部品を配置していきます。
Screenshot 2024-05-02 at 18.30.39.png

好きな場所にビジュアライゼーションを配置します。
Screenshot 2024-05-02 at 18.30.56.png

右側のペインでビジュアライゼーションの設定を行っていきます。
Screenshot 2024-05-02 at 18.31.30.png
Screenshot 2024-05-02 at 18.31.55.png

ビジュアライゼーションを配置した際に上部に表示されるのはプロンプトボックスです。ここに自然文を入力することで、ビジュアライゼーションを生成させることも可能です。
Screenshot 2024-05-02 at 18.32.14.png
Screenshot 2024-05-02 at 18.32.32.png

なお、日本語でも動作します。

1時間ごとの降車時間に対する平均金額の棒グラフ

Screenshot 2024-05-02 at 18.33.31.png

散布図も追加します。
Screenshot 2024-05-02 at 18.34.29.png

フィルターの作成

Screenshot 2024-05-02 at 18.34.50.png

フィルターを配置して、タイトルや対象のデータなどの設定を行います。
Screenshot 2024-05-02 at 18.35.33.png
Screenshot 2024-05-02 at 18.36.25.png

テキストボックスの追加

説明文を記載するためなどの目的で、テキストボックスを追加することもできます。
Screenshot 2024-05-02 at 18.36.55.png

マークダウンを記載できるので、画像を埋め込むこともできます。
Screenshot 2024-05-02 at 18.42.03.png
Screenshot 2024-05-02 at 18.42.12.png

ダッシュボードの公開

この時点ではダッシュボードは下書きの状態です。右上の公開をクリックします。権限の設定を行い公開をクリックすることで、アクセス権に基づき他のユーザーもダッシュボードにアクセスできるようになります。
Screenshot 2024-05-02 at 18.42.20.png
Screenshot 2024-05-02 at 18.43.10.png

ご活用ください!

はじめてのDatabricks

はじめてのDatabricks

Databricks無料トライアル

Databricks無料トライアル

1
0
0

Register as a new user and use Qiita more conveniently

  1. You get articles that match your needs
  2. You can efficiently read back useful information
  3. You can use dark theme
What you can do with signing up
1
0

Delete article

Deleted articles cannot be recovered.

Draft of this article would be also deleted.

Are you sure you want to delete this article?